Description
Project Rationale and Linkage to Country/Regional Strategy
Impact

Cross border trade and investment between NTT and Timor-Leste facilitated (TA defined)

Project Outcome
Description of Outcome

Enabling environment for cross border trade in livestock and tourism cooperation promoted between Timor-Leste and NTT

Progress Toward Outcome
Implementation Progress
Description of Project Outputs

Advice and training for cross border transport and trade delivered

Animal health certifications required for livestock trade supported

Assets for joint tourism itineraries mapped
